Kevala
samadhiThe absolute, the sole without a second. As kevala kumbhaka it designates the spontaneous retention of breath in which both inhalation and exhalation cease, a sign that prāṇa has stabilized completely. In the Yoga Sūtras, kevala is linked to kaivalya — the absolute isolation of puruṣa from prakṛti — the final state where consciousness rests in itself without object or agent.
